3. 数据类型不匹配。如果您试图将不匹配的数据类型插入数据库中,MySQL将无法保存数据。请确保将正确的数据类型用于每个列,并确保在编写SQL查询时使用正确的语法。4. 数据长度限制。如果您试图插入一个超出表中列数据长度限制的数据,MySQL将无法保存数据。请确保插入的数据长度不超过表中定义的最大长度。
如果您的MySQL表结构不正确,那么数据很难被保存。在这种情况下,您需要检查您的表结构是否与您的数据类型匹配。例如,如果您存储一个字符串类型的数据,但表结构定义为整型,则数据将无法保存。此外,您还应该检查字段的长度和是否允许为空。3. 检查MySQL配置 MySQL配置也可能导致无法保存数据的问题。在...
1. 锁定表:如果某个表被锁定,你就无法对其进行更改。常见的原因是该表正在被其他用户或操作锁定。2. 权限限制:如果您没有足够的权限来对数据库进行更改,则可能无法保存更改。3. 数据库正在运行某些操作:如果数据库正在进行某些操作,例如备份、复制或重建索引,则可能无法对数据库进行更改。4. 数据...
问题出现的原因 在MySQL中,存储小数数据通常使用FLOAT或DOUBLE类型。这两种数据类型都可以存储小数数据,但它们的存储方式不同。FLOAT类型使用4个字节存储,而DOUBLE类型使用8个字节存储。这意味着DOUBLE类型可以存储更大、更准确的小数值。但是,无论你使用哪种类型,都可能会出现无法保存小数数据的问题。问...
mysql> CREATE TABLE table_name (…);当然,在执行这个操作之前,我们需要备份原来的表数据,以免数据丢失。3. 结论 在MySQL使用过程中,我们可能会遇到各种错误。如果出现“无法保存表”的错误,我们可以先检查磁盘空间、存储引擎等因素,然后尝试重新建立表。在遇到类似问题时,我们需要仔细分析错误...